Two health officials at Oregon Department of Corrections placed on leave amid investigation
The Oregon Department of Corrections placed its chief of medicine and the assistant director for health services on paid administrative leave on Thursday, pending a human resources investigation. The department declined to give any details about the investigation into Dr. Warren Roberts, its chief of medicine, and Joe Bugher, the agency’s assistant director of health services, who were put on leave.
